18GTN 750: ADDING DEPARTURES, ARRIVALS, AND APPROACHES
Activate a leg from a charted hold to the next waypoint
If your clearance includes a waypoint that is also a charted hold, you can skip the hold by activating the leg
from the holding x that extends to the next waypoint. For example, if ATC vectors you to join the nal ap-
proach course outside an IAF that is a waypoint for a HILPT, you can activate the leg from the holding x to
the nal approach x.
1. On the Active Flight Plan page, within the procedure, TOUCH the name of the waypoint aer the hold.
2. TOUCH Activate Leg, in the Waypoint Options.
3. In the “Activate Leg? ...” conrm screen, verify the leg and TOUCH OK.
Create a custom hold at a waypoint in the active flight plan
1. On the Active Flight Plan page, TOUCH the waypoint at which you want to create a hold.
2. TOUCH Hold At Waypoint in the Waypoint Options.
3. In the Hold At Waypoint screen:
a. To specify the holding course, TOUCH Course and
use the keypad to enter the course.
b. By default, the holding course is inbound to the hold-
ing x. To dene the course as the outbound track,
TOUCH Direction.
c. Right turns are standard. To specify le turns,
TOUCH Turn.
d. Timed legs are standard. To specify a distance hold,
TOUCH Leg Type.
e. If you specied a timed leg, the standard is one min-
ute. To specify a dierent inbound time, TOUCH Leg
Time and use the keypad to enter a time in minutes
and seconds.
f. If you specied a distance, TOUCH Leg Distance and
use the keypad to enter a distance in nautical miles.
g. To enter the EFC time, TOUCH Expect Further
Clearance and use the keypad to enter the time.
h. When done dening the hold, TOUCH Load Hold.
4. e GTN inserts the hold in the active ight plan below
the waypoint originally selected.
Leave a hold and resume waypoint sequencing
Once you’re in a hold and the GTN is in SUSP mode, you must
manually switch the GTN back to automatic waypoint sequenc-
ing to leave the hold.
A. On the Map page, TOUCH the UNSUSP button at the
bottom of the display; or
B. On the Active Flight Plan page,
1. TOUCH the waypoint below the hold.
2. TOUCH Activate Leg.
3. TOUCH OK.
